Quick answer
The Land of Nod Recalls Children's Canopies Due to Entrapment and Strangulation Hazards is CPSC recall #09108, announced on January 28, 2009. The CPSC cites the following hazard: The recalled canopies involve the "Home Sweet Playhome" model made of 100% cotton gingham fabric draped from a bamboo hoop which is suspended from the ceiling to create a cylindrical play space measuring 36 inches wide and 9 feet tall. The canopies have an open bottom, a "door" and three multi-paned "windows." They were sold in blue and pink. "Home Sweet Playhome" canopies sold after October 2005 are not included in this recall. "The Land of Nod" is printed on a woven label on the canopy. The remedy is consumers should immediately stop using the canopies and take them away from children. contact the land of nod to receive a free replacement fabric portion of the canopy and a $15 gift card..
